Strathcona County has issued Request for Supplier Qualifications RFSQ 26.0087 to identify eligible providers for utilities minor infrastructure installation and repair. The scope of work focuses on the maintenance and installation of water and wastewater collection infrastructure, specifically linear assets ranging from 3/4 to 12 inches in diameter across various pipe types and weights. Additionally, the deliverables include necessary landscaping services on both public and private properties within the legal boundaries of the county. Interested respondents must obtain the RFSQ documents through the Euna portal. The submission deadline for this solicitation is October 13, 2026, at 8:00 PM. Primary inquiries and coordination are managed by Murray Reid, the Senior Procurement and Contract Advisor for Strathcona County, with the performance of the work taking place in Alberta.

RFSQ documents should be obtained from the Euna (formally Bonfire) portal at https://strathcona.bonfirehub.ca. This Request for Supplier Qualifications (“RFSQ”) is an invitation by Strathcona County (the “County”) to prospective respondents to qualify for eligibility to provide Utilities Minor Infrastructure Installation and Repair, as further described in Section A of the RFSQ Particulars (Appendix A) (the “Deliverables”). The County is seeking qualified respondents for minor infrastructure installation and repairs, including but not limited to, maintenance, and installation of water and wastewater collection infrastructure (linear assets 3/4” to 12” in diameter of various pipe types and weights). The Deliverables include related landscaping on public and private property within the legal boundaries of Strathcona County.

The Inland Feeder/SBVMWD Foothill PS Intertie, Stage 1 project in Highland, California, involves the installation of extensive water infrastructure for the Metropolitan Water District of Southern California. The scope of work includes furnishing and installing approximately 2,150 linear feet of 54-inch to 66-inch diameter steel pipe and 200 linear feet of 144-inch diameter steel pipe. The project requires the installation of both contractor-furnished and Metropolitan-furnished valves, including 54-inch and 132-inch diameter valves and tie-ins ranging from 54 to 145.5 inches. Additional structural requirements include the construction of four surge tanks, two valve vaults, an air compressor yard structure, and various drainage improvements. The technical scope further encompasses electrical upgrades, instrumentation and controls, piping systems, and specialized civil works such as the excavation of cobbles and large boulders, welding, disinfection, and surface restoration.
